Website Redesign Planner
Run a disciplined website redesign planning process grounded in source material and competitive intelligence. Reuse Firecrawl and frontend design skills; this skill coordinates the workflow and defines the client decision app.
Operating Rules
- Treat competitor and market research output as evidence, not source copy. Never reuse competitor copy, layouts, logos, or protected assets in the built site.
- Keep client-review examples familiar and source-grounded by default: preserve the source site's real copy, media, section intent, CTA intent, and brand recognition unless the user explicitly asks for a dramatic rebrand or repositioning.
- Do not build the production website during the default workflow. Stop at a SvelteKit report app, client-review examples, and production-build brief.
- Default stack: Bun, SvelteKit, TypeScript, Tailwind,
@tailwindcss/vite, and @sveltejs/adapter-static.
- Generate the report app at the project root for fresh projects. For existing projects, inspect first and ask before converting a non-SvelteKit stack.
- Keep all research artifacts in
.firecrawl/ or research/. Add .firecrawl/ to .gitignore if creating files in a repo.
- Produce
DESIGN.md, .impeccable.md, and a project-local design-system skill before creating high-fidelity examples or final-site UI.
- Use project-specific design-system rules for every report page, design-system option, and homepage example after Phase 4.
- Cite or link evidence in reports and summarize confidence when public data is incomplete.
- Generate real Playwright screenshots for example cards before handoff.

Phase 1: Gather & Understand
- Verify Firecrawl setup with
firecrawl --status. If not configured, use the installed Firecrawl onboarding/install skill.
- If an existing URL is provided, crawl or download the site:
- Use Firecrawl crawl/download skills.
- Capture page content, headings, metadata, images/alt text, links, navigation, CTAs, forms, trust signals, service pages, footer data, and visible SEO structure.
- Save outputs under
.firecrawl/source-site/ or equivalent.
- If starting fresh, build the business profile from user input and public sources.
- Produce a compact business brief:
- offer, audience, service area, conversion goal
- current messaging strengths and gaps
- brand and visual signals
- content inventory and likely page model
Phase 2: Competitive Research
- Read
references/research-data-rules.md.
- Identify top competitors using hybrid evidence:
- user-provided competitors first
- local/organic search visibility
- visible Google review signals where available
- Trustpilot or relevant review platforms where available
- supplied API exports or SEO data when provided
- Rank five competitors with confidence notes. Do not invent unavailable review counts, ratings, search volume, or rankings.
- Scrape each competitor for design, content, branding, logos, color cues, SEO signals, CTAs, offers, social proof, and trust signals.
- Synthesize shared winner patterns and market-specific opportunities.
Phase 3: Analysis Report
Create or update the SvelteKit report app. For fresh projects, copy assets/sveltekit-report-app-template/ into the project root, then replace the sample data in src/lib/report-data.ts with research-backed content.
Run a homepage Lighthouse capture as part of the audit workflow:
- set
reportMeta.sourceSite.url in src/lib/report-data.ts
- run
bun run capture:lighthouse
- if bundled Chromium cannot complete the capture, retry with a local Chrome binary, for example
CHROME_PATH="/Applications/Google Chrome.app/Contents/MacOS/Google Chrome" bun run capture:lighthouse
- keep the full JSON artifact at
research/lighthouse/homepage.report.json
- use
src/lib/content/lighthouse-homepage.json as the normalized UI summary artifact
- if Lighthouse reaches the page but fails during controlled navigation, preserve the failed artifact and show the failure state honestly in
/audit rather than fabricating category scores
The Analysis section at / must include:
- executive summary and recommended positioning
- five competitor profiles with logos/screenshots when legally and technically obtainable
- side-by-side brand colors, typography notes, CTAs, offers, proof, and SEO signals
- SEO landscape, keyword/topic gaps, trust gaps, and content recommendations
- prioritized rebuild strategy backed by captured evidence
- limitations section for missing or low-confidence data
The Audit section at /audit must include source-site findings, UX issues, conversion gaps, content gaps, technical/SEO observations, accessibility notes, prioritized fixes, and a dedicated Lighthouse snapshot for the homepage with category scores, key lab metrics, capture metadata, and top technical opportunities. The Lighthouse snapshot must use the bundled responsive audit layout: container-aware score/metric/opportunity grids, cleaned Lighthouse markdown descriptions, graceful failure state, and metric-specific good/needs-improvement/poor colors for key lab metric values.
Do not export a PDF by default. Keep the report client-ready in the SvelteKit app unless the user explicitly asks for another format.

Quality Gates
- No phase can rely only on guesses when public data or provided files can be inspected.
- Report claims must map to captured sources or be labeled as inference.
- Design system must be tailored to the specific market and business, not generic Tailwind defaults.
- Report pages and examples must be accessible, responsive, visually consistent, and easy for non-technical clients to review.
- Example screenshots must be real captures of the rendered routes, not hand-drawn placeholders.
- The final report app must be shareable as one linked website with prerendered routes.
- The workflow must not build the production website unless the user explicitly starts a final-site build task.
